Atal Pension Yojana Achieves Historic 9 Crore Enrolment Milestone

The Atal Pension Yojana (APY) has reached a major milestone by crossing 9 crore total enrolments, marking one of the strongest expansions of India’s social security ecosystem in recent years. Launched in 2015, the scheme is designed to provide a guaranteed monthly pension after the age of 60 for workers, especially in the unorganised sector.

According to official updates, the scheme recorded its highest-ever annual addition in FY 2025–26 with over 1.35 crore new subscribers, showing rising awareness about retirement planning among citizens .

📌 Role of Financial Inclusion in Expansion

APY primarily targets workers in the unorganised sector, including labourers, small traders, and daily wage earners. With digital banking and direct benefit transfer systems, enrolment has become easier, enabling wider coverage across India.

📌 Government Push and Institutional Support

The Pension Fund Regulatory and Development Authority (PFRDA), along with banks and post offices, has played a key role in spreading awareness. Continuous government outreach campaigns have significantly improved participation, especially in rural areas.

📚 Historical Context

📌 Launch and Background of APY

The Atal Pension Yojana was launched in 2015 by the Government of India to provide income security to citizens in their old age. It replaced earlier pension initiatives aimed at informal workers.

📌 Need for the Scheme

India has a large informal workforce, and most workers lacked retirement savings. APY was introduced to bridge this gap by offering a simple, guaranteed pension model supported by the government.

FAQs – Atal Pension Yojana (APY) & 9 Crore Enrolment Update

Q1. What is Atal Pension Yojana (APY)?

Atal Pension Yojana is a government-backed pension scheme launched in 2015 to provide guaranteed monthly pension after the age of 60, mainly for workers in the unorganised sector.

Q2. Who regulates the Atal Pension Yojana?

The scheme is regulated by the Pension Fund Regulatory and Development Authority (PFRDA) under the Ministry of Finance.

Q3. What is the pension amount under APY?

Subscribers can receive a fixed pension of ₹1,000 to ₹5,000 per month, depending on their contribution and entry age.

Q4. What is the minimum eligibility age for APY?

The minimum age to join APY is 18 years, and the maximum entry age is 40 years.
